Market Dynamics
The Germany Military Aircraft Digital Glass Cockpit Systems market has experienced significant growth in recent years, driven by the increasing demand for advanced technology in military flying operations. The adoption of digital glass cockpit systems has revolutionized the way military pilots fly and operate aircraft, leading to improved situational awareness, enhanced safety, and operational efficiency. One of the key factors driving the market growth is the need to modernize existing military aircraft with advanced avionics systems. With the rapid development of military technology and the growing complexity of aircraft systems, there is a high demand for digital glass cockpit systems that can provide real-time data and improved functionality. These systems are equipped with advanced capabilities such as touch screen displays, integrated flight management systems, direct voice input, and Heads-Up Displays (HUDs), allowing pilots to perform their duties more efficiently and effectively. The growing focus on reducing pilot workload and enhancing flight safety is also propelling the adoption of digital glass cockpit systems in military aircraft. These systems provide a comprehensive and intuitive interface for pilots to monitor critical aircraft parameters, reducing the risk of human error.
The advanced avionics systems integrated into digital cockpits also enable pilots to monitor multiple displays simultaneously, ensuring an improved understanding of the flight situation. Moreover, the desire for fuel efficiency and cost reduction is also a significant factor driving the demand for digital glass cockpit systems in the Germany Military Aircraft market. These systems offer improved fuel efficiency and operational safety by optimizing route planning, reducing maintenance costs, and minimizing the aircraft weight. They also provide better performance in terms of precision landing, navigation, and target tracking, which are crucial for military aircraft operations. On the other hand, the high cost associated with the installation and maintenance of these systems is a major restraining factor for the market. The maintenance and repair of digital glass cockpit systems require specialized skills and equipment, making it a costly affair for military organizations with limited budgets. However, with the advancement of technology and the increasing competition among market players, the costs associated with these systems are gradually decreasing, thus driving the market growth.
In conclusion, the Germany Military Aircraft Digital Glass Cockpit Systems market has a promising outlook due to the increasing need for advanced avionics systems and the growing focus on flight safety and efficiency. As the military aviation industry continues to evolve, the demand for these systems is expected to grow, further driving the market size in the coming years.
